    I would do two tests.  Start up the Mac in Safe Mode
    http://support.apple.com/kb/ht1564
    Although some things will not work in Safe Mode, you can use Safari.  Does this problem happen in Safe Mode?  If it does not, there may be some system extension or background process running when you start up nornally, that is causing this problem.
    To further narrow down the cause, start up normally and create a new user account in System Preferences Users & Groups pane.  The new user account can be Admin or Standard.  Log out and log in to the new user account (do not use Fast User Switching).  In the new user account, does this problem occur?  If it does, the cause is likely to be at the system level.  If does not, the cause is likely to be something that runs in the background, when you log in to your usual user account.
    Doing these test will allow additional troubleshooting to be more focused.

    The first editions of the Mac Pro (1,1 thru 2,1) were born in 2005 with existsing 32-bit firmware and ML is becoming 64-bit only.
    Not that Vista and PCs don't use 32-bit firmware and still have 64-bit kernel. If you ever tried Windows 64-bit you know the trouble we have with that on these models as well.
    However, even Windows when it sees EFI and 64-bit OS expects to see Unified EFI aka EFI64 / UEFI 2.x rather than the older EFI 1.x that we have.
    You can order Lion 10.7 and use that. Or you can go into the hackintosh route and treat the Mac as a PC almost and dual-boot loader to get there. But you would have to look elsewhere for support and help on other forums.
